Part Number: WAP-3701
The National Instruments WAP-3701 is a robust wireless transmitter designed for industrial applications, functioning as an access point, bridge, and client in a single unit. This transmitter operates under both IEEE 802.11b and 802.11g standards, ensuring reliable wireless connectivity in challenging environments. It features dual redundant power inputs accepting a voltage range of 12 to 45 VDC, making it adaptable to various power supply configurations. The device is engineered for DIN rail mounting, facilitating installation in control cabinets and factory setups.
The WAP-3701 is equipped with advanced security features, including support for WPA, IEEE 802.1X, and MAC address filtering, along with 64-bit and 128-bit WEP encryption, providing secure data transmission across networks. Management is simplified through a built-in web console that allows for easy configuration of wireless settings, including RF channel selection, data rates, and transmission power adjustments. With data rates reaching up to 54 Mbps through OFDM modulation, the transmitter is optimized for high performance and includes capabilities for load balancing across multiple access points. It operates in both access point and bridge modes, serving as a dynamic or static LAN-to-LAN bridge that facilitates seamless data exchange between wired and wireless networks.
The WAP-3701 includes two swivel RP-SMA antennas to enhance signal reception. Housed in a sturdy IP30-rated metal enclosure, the unit supports operating temperatures from 0 to 60°C (32 to 140°F) and storage temperatures from -20 to 70°C (-4 to 158°F), ensuring durability in demanding conditions. It operates efficiently within an ambient non-condensing relative humidity range of 5 to 95%. The combination of flexibility, reliability, and heightened security makes the WAP-3701 an ideal solution for industrial environments requiring robust network access and data protection.
